linux系统:是多用户多任务分时操作系统
cat /etc/group :查看所有的用户组
cat /etc/passwd:查看所有的用户
linux–group命令
groupadd:添加用户组
- 语法 :
groupadd 【option】 【用户组】 - 选项【option】:
g GID 指定新用户组的组标识号(GID)。
o 一般与-g选项同时使用,表示新用户组的GID可以与系统已有用户组的GID相同。 - 案例:
groupadd hadoop
- 语法 :
groupdel:删除用户组
- 语法:
groupdel 【用户组】
- 语法:
groupmod:修改用户组
- 语法:
groupmod 【option】 【用户组】 - 选项【option】
g GID 为用户组指定新的组标识号。
o 与-g选项同时使用,用户组的新GID可以与系统已有用户组的GID相同。
n新用户组 将用户组的名字改为新名字
- 语法:
linux–user命令
useradd:添加用户组
- 语法 :
useradd【option】 【用户名】 - 选项【option】:
-c comment 指定一段注释性描述。
-d 目录 指定用户主目录,如果此目录不存在,则同时使用-m选项,可以创建主目录。
-g 用户组 指定用户所属的用户组。
-G 用户组,用户组 指定用户所属的附加组。
-s Shell文件 指定用户的登录Shell。
-u 用户号 指定用户的用户号,如果同时有-o选项,则可以重复使用其他用户的标识号。 - 案例:
useradd -g hadoop hbase
- 语法 :
userdel:删除用户
- 语法:
userdel 【option】 【用户组】 - 选项【option】:
-r,它的作用是把用户的主目录一起删除
- 语法:
usermod:修改用户
- 语法:
usermod【option】 【用户】 - 选项【option】
-c comment 指定一段注释性描述。
-d 目录 指定用户主目录,如果此目录不存在,则同时使用-m选项,可以创建主目录。
-g 用户组 指定用户所属的用户组。
-G 用户组,用户组 指定用户所属的附加组。
-s Shell文件 指定用户的登录Shell。
-u 用户号 指定用户的用户号,如果同时有-o选项,则可以重复使用其他用户的标识号。
-l 新用户名
- 语法:
linux–passwd命令
- passwd:指定修改用户指令
- 语法 :
passwd【option】 【用户名】 - 选项【option】:
-l 锁定口令,即禁用账号。
-u 口令解锁。
-d 使账号无口令。
-f 强迫用户下次登录时修改口令。 - 案例:
passwd
Old password:**
New password:*
Re-enter new password:*
-
- 语法 :
- passwd:指定修改用户指令